India’s growing position as a global export hub has increased the requirement for reliable exporter of record services. The exporter of record meaning, is straightforward: it refers to the organization that officially manages all legal export duties for goods leaving the country. From confirming goods are correctly classified under the HS Code and HTS harmonized tariff schedules to preparing shipping documents and dealing with duties, the exporter of record responsibilities cover critical approval tasks. Companies that understand the exporter of record definition know how vital this role is for easy trade.

Understanding Exporter of Record in India

For any organization planning an export record from India, understanding the process is necessary. An EOR exporter of record works as the legal entity listed in the customs documents. They confirm all export documents, taxes, duties, and good categorizations are correct. They work closely with customs brokers to confirm correct filing and smooth across the region. Depending on an exporter of record, organizations avoid common issues such as miscategorizations of goods, incorrect use of HTS harmonized tariff Schedule codes, or mistakes in Incoterms. The EOR manages the complete export journey from document preparation to final customs clearance, helping businesses focus on sales rather than agreement headaches.

DID YOU KNOW?

India has launched the Export Promotion Mission (EPM) with a ₹25,060 crore outlay to strengthen its export ecosystem by improving trade finance, market access, logistics, and global competitiveness, especially for MSMEs and new exporters.
